GB Ensemble at Café Oto 2
When
Tuesday, 16 May 2023
Where
Café Oto, 18-22 Ashwin St, London E8 3DL
Our second night as part of our annual Café Oto performances includes UK premieres of two Gnossiennes, after Satie – first performed in Lyon June 2022. Gavin was appointed British Ambassador for the Fondation Erik Satie in the 1970s (and John Cage was the American Ambassador).
It also includes a longer version of Jesus’ Blood Never Failed Me Yet, based on the version that we gave in St Katherine Cree Church last April as part of Fragments, a festival celebrating the centenary of T S Eliot’s The Wasteland
Concert 2, May 16
Part 1
Gnossienne 1 after Satie (2 pianos, electric guitar)
Gnossienne 4 after Satie (2 pianos, electric guitar)
My First Homage (revised 2022) (2 pianos, electric guitar, bass)
After the Requiem (electric guitar, 2 violas, cello, bass)
Lauda con sordino (solo cello Audrey Riley, electric guitar, piano – GB)
Part 2
Jesus’ Blood Never Failed Me Yet (Everyone)
Epilogue from Wonderlawn (Everyone – Morgan Goff solo viola)
GB (electric piano/bass), Dave Smith (piano), James Woodrow (electric guitar), Morgan Goff, Nick Barr (violas), Nick Cooper, Audrey Riley, Ziella Bryars, Orlanda Bryars (cellos), Yuri Bryars (piano/bass)
